Userland: Use getline instead of Core::File::standard_input in grep
Core::IODevice (which Core::File inherits from) does not have a reasonable way to block for a line. grep was spinning on IODevice::read_line, passing endless empty strings to the matcher lambda. Use getline instead, which will at least block in the Kernel for characters to be available on stdin and only return full lines (or eof)
